Air Filtration Systems

The 1960s–1970s ranch homes dominating Cupertino’s residential core were built when central AC wasn’t standard, meaning many systems lack adequate filtration infrastructure. We design air filtration upgrades that work within existing duct constraints — MERV 13+ media filters, 5-inch cabinet upgrades, or bypass HEPA configurations for homes with severely undersized returns. In Cupertino’s 95014 and 95015 ZIP codes, we’ve found that homes near Stevens Creek Boulevard with newer HVAC additions particularly benefit from filtration upgrades that catch pollen from the nearby riparian corridor.

ERV and HRV Ventilation Systems

Cupertino’s rapidly rising land values have pushed extensive whole-home renovations and ADU additions, making controlled ventilation essential for code compliance and actual air quality. An Energy Recovery Ventilator (ERV) pre-conditions incoming air using exhaust air energy — critical for Cupertino’s dry summers and mild winters. For detached workshops, home offices, or ADUs common in the larger Rancho Rinconada lots, ERVs ventilate without dumping conditioned air. We size these systems against your actual load calculations, not rule-of-thumb estimates.

UV Air Purifier Installation

UV-C lamp installation in Cupertino runs $150–$650 and targets biological growth on evaporator coils — particularly relevant for homes with the damp coil conditions we see in oversized, short-cycling systems. The Santa Clara Valley’s pollen load makes coil fouling a recurring issue, and UV lamps reduce the maintenance burden between seasonal tune-ups. We install UV systems compatible with Carrier, Trane, Bryant, and American Standard air handlers common in Cupertino retrofits.

Common Air Quality & Ventilation Problems We See in Cupertino Homes

  • Crawlspace dampness in Monta Vista destroying ductwork. The morning marine layer keeps hillside crawlspaces persistently damp, accelerating mastic joint failure and insulation degradation in under-floor duct runs. We regularly find collapsed flex duct and corroded metal connections that have been misdiagnosed as “normal aging.”
  • Oversized AC systems causing humidity control failures. Cupertino’s flatland microclimate runs measurably warmer than hillside neighborhoods just two miles west. A system correctly sized for a Monta Vista home can be severely oversized on the flats near I-280, leading to short cycling, poor dehumidification, and clammy indoor air.
  • Undersized return-air ducts in 1960s ranch homes. Most Cupertino ranches were built with gas furnace-only heating and returns sized for roughly half the airflow modern heat pumps and AC systems require. The result is reduced airflow, higher static pressure, and indoor air quality that degrades after any upgrade.
  • Detached workshops and ADUs with no ventilation strategy. Cupertino’s larger lots and renovation culture has produced numerous accessory structures that need dedicated ventilation without compromising the main home’s conditioning. ERV systems solve this, but they’re rarely specced correctly without load calculations that account for actual occupancy patterns.
